It depends on category to category. For me, it is a very good learning experience. I learnt a lot from my success manager too also I enjoy 7 day early payment clearance. Tomorrow I have another meeting with my success manager. 

Coupons also a great feature of Seller Plus. I sent coupons to my repeated buyers and they are really happy that I am providing coupons to them to value our collaboration.  

Depth Analytics also helps to figure out gig performance on the marketplace.

I was one of the first 200 people that got in with the special rate. I think it's worth it, I guess it depends on what you expect. I like it for the fast customer support resolutions and also the 7-day clearance even if you're not a TRS. I didn't talk with the success manager that much, mostly due to being very busy myself and not scheduling meetings just to have them.

But overall it seems like an OK service. Is it mandatory? No. Will it help? It depends on what issues you are facing. Each person gets it for different reasons. At the rate I got it, feels ok. It might be worth $30 if you are talking with the success manager monthly.

Well the gig performance can be down due to various things.

  • Someone wrote a bad private review, or more people, and the success manager won't tell you who or how many, for obvious reasons.
  • You had bad public reviews 
  • You delivered orders late
  • You had few orders when compared to your competitors within the past 2 months.
  • You canceled quite a bit of orders and don't have a large workflow to cover that stuff, hence the order completion rate is much lower than normal.

All these things and others will obviously have a negative impact on your overall performance. Most likely one of those things happened or more, and others surpassed you because you have a lower performance when compared to them.

I applied to the programme a month into starting my account and if I remember correctly was accepted a couple of weeks later. That was 10 months ago. As @donnovan86mentioned, it's worth it simply not to have to wait for fund clearance. You also get more buyer requests apparently, but let's face it, 100% of cr*p is a 100% of cr*p, no matter how big the dung heap, so that didn't really matter to me. 

Since hitting L2 in March, after solid month on month growth, my orders became very erratic. My success manager has been helpful most of the time, but hasn't always made the best suggestions to get things back on track in my opinion. (There are a lot of L2 sellers on Fiverr, so maybe I'm just a victim of L2 'blues' and have to put up with it).  

Overall, I would suggest give it a go. It's not a huge outlay and for me, I think it's been more of a benefit and worthwhile expense rather than a waste. Hope that helps.

Recently, I've noticed the option to send coupons integrated in any custom offer I set up. I'd have to pay attention to it over a longer period, but I think literally any custom offer, including very regular and happy customers, and I just opened a custom offer form for a new person who messaged me but about something I don't offer, to check, same.

It says "x will be able to use the coupon for 24h only", so, at least here, it doesn't seem to be linked to Fiverr choosing selected customers to kind of recommend you to send them one, but more as a little incentive for people to quickly make up their mind.

Seller+ will have a different worth for different people, depending on what you can/want to do with the features, but I'd recommend anyone who gets the option to at least try it out for a month, why wouldn't you, if it's not worth a monthly subscription for you, you can opt out again, after all.
